1. A network-independent location-aware protocol for communicating with location-aware wireless mobile devices, the network-independent location-aware protocol stored as data bits in a pre-determined format on a computer readable medium encoded with a computer program, comprising:

  • a location-aware management message for sending and receiving management messages to and from location-aware wireless mobile devices;

    a location-aware event message for sending and receiving emergency or non-emergency event messages to and from location-aware wireless mobile devices, wherein the location-aware event message accepts alert information from a plurality of information sources on an information repository, wherein the information repository is in communications with the plurality of information sources via an information network, wherein the alert information is generated from emergency or non-emergency events, and wherein the alert information includes information emergency or non-emergency events for a specific geographic area, and wherein the accepted alert information is formatted into a network-independent location-aware protocol message; and

    a location-aware commerce message for sending and receiving commerce messages to and from location-aware wireless mobile devices;

    wherein the network-independent location-aware protocol messages can be simultaneously transmitted over a plurality of different types of wireless transport networks for a plurality of different types of location-aware mobile devices in a plurality of different locations in a specific geographic area,wherein the location-aware management message, the location-aware event message and the location-aware commerce message are stored as data bits in a pre-determined format comprising a network-independent location-aware protocol to support and deliver location-aware services over a wireless or wired transport network transparently regardless of the actual networking protocols being used on the wireless or wired transport network, andwherein the network-independent location-aware protocol messages can be sent to a plurality of different types of location-aware mobile wireless network devices in communications with the plurality of different types of transport networks via a plurality of uniform mobile user network message interfaces associated with the plurality of different types of transport networks.
